Co-reporter:Yoko Sakata, Satomi Fukushima, Shigehisa Akine and Jun-ichiro Setsune  
Chemical Communications 2016 vol. 52(Issue 6) pp:1278-1281
Publication Date(Web):12 Nov 2015
DOI:10.1039/C5CC07625K
A newly synthesized dipyrrinone derivative bearing an ethoxycarbonyl group at the pyrrolic-α position exhibited solvent-dependent dual-mode photochromism between T- and P-types. While this molecule underwent thermally reversible (T-type) photoresponsive reaction in chloroform, it became a thermally irreversible (P-type) system in methanol.
